AI Summary
- Appropriates $128,178,600 to the Department of Fish and Game for fiscal year 2022 (July 1, 2021 through June 30, 2022)
- Funds distributed across six major programs: Administration ($24,036,500), Enforcement ($13,063,500), Fisheries ($45,263,200), Wildlife ($27,670,000), Communications ($5,373,000), and Wildlife Mitigation and Habitat Conservation ($12,772,400)
- Authorizes a maximum of 553.00 full-time equivalent positions during the fiscal year period, with any increases requiring specific Governor authorization and Joint Finance-Appropriations Committee notification
- Funding sources include Fish and Game license funds, Fish and Game other funds, set-aside funds, trust funds, and federal funds allocated across multiple expense categories
Legislative Description
Relates to the appropriation to the Department of Fish and Game for fiscal year 2022.
